SI-COM II builds on Phase I and the NORAQ framework to strengthen migration governance in Iraq. The project supports the Government of Iraq and the Kurdistan Regional Government in developing coordinated, rights-based, and data-driven migration systems that improve reintegration, reduce irregular migration, and strengthen institutional capacity. Implemented by ICMPD, the Swedish Migration Agency (SMA), and the Swedish Police Authority (SPA), the project focuses on expanding Migrant Resource Centres (MRCs), strengthening migration governance institutions, advancing digital migration management, and improving border governance through implementation of the National Integrated Border Management Strategy.

In the Kurdistan Region of Iraq, the Project Officer supports the implementation and coordination of activities related to border management, migration governance, MRCs, and institutional capacity development. Reporting to the SI-COM II Project Manager, the role assists with project implementation, stakeholder coordination, monitoring, reporting, and the integration of human rights, gender equality, protection, and inclusion principles.

The position requires experience in migration management, border governance, or institutional capacity development, with stakeholder engagement skills. Experience applying human rights-based, gender-sensitive, and inclusive approaches is an asset. Fluency in English, Arabic, and Kurdish is required; knowledge of additional Iraqi languages or dialects is an asset.
